How they compare

Sierra Leone currently reports 0.8077 tonnes per hectare against 0.7846 tonnes per hectare in Mauritania, a difference of 0.0231 tonnes per hectare.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 64 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Sierra Leone ahead.

Mauritania ranks 95th and Sierra Leone ranks 93rd of 119 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Mauritania averaged higher in 1 and Sierra Leone in 6.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mauritania Sierra Leone Difference Ahead
1960s 0.4883 tonnes per hectare 1.22 tonnes per hectare 0.734 tonnes per hectare Sierra Leone
1970s 0.5591 tonnes per hectare 1.12 tonnes per hectare 0.5571 tonnes per hectare Sierra Leone
1980s 0.7112 tonnes per hectare 0.8855 tonnes per hectare 0.1743 tonnes per hectare Sierra Leone
1990s 0.7526 tonnes per hectare 0.9447 tonnes per hectare 0.1922 tonnes per hectare Sierra Leone
2000s 0.7982 tonnes per hectare 0.7435 tonnes per hectare 0.0547 tonnes per hectare Mauritania
2010s 0.7993 tonnes per hectare 0.9383 tonnes per hectare 0.139 tonnes per hectare Sierra Leone
2020s 0.7801 tonnes per hectare 1.29 tonnes per hectare 0.5064 tonnes per hectare Sierra Leone

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
